Retirement tax questions

First, make sure your birthdate is correct in the Personal Info section.

 

For a normal retirement distribution, you should see Code 7 in Box 7 of your 1099-R.

 

If you're using TurboTax Online, clear your Cache and Cookies and return to the 1099-R entry area.

 

If you imported your 1099-R, you may delete/re-enter manually.

 

You can also Delete Form 5329; however it may regenerate if the 1099-R (or birthdate) are incorrectly entered.
